MySQL | 文字列
文字列を結合する
concat 関数を使用すると、文字列またはカラムの内容を結合できる。
関数形式
concat(文字列またはカラム名, 文字列またはカラム名, ...)
使用例
SELECT concat("abc","123")
上記の例を実行すると、次のように表示される。
abc123
左から文字列を切り出す
left 関数を使用すると、文字列を左から切り出すことができる。
関数形式
left(カラム名または文字列, 左から切り出す文字列の長さ)
使用例
SELECT left("abcdef", 3)
上記の例を実行すると、次のように表示される。
abc
右から文字列を切り出す
right 関数を使用すると、文字列を右から切り出すことができる。
関数形式
right(カラム名または文字列, 長さ)
使用例
SELECT right("abcdef", 3)
上記の例を実行すると、次のように表示される。
def
中間から文字列を切り出す
substring 関数を使用すると、文字列の途中から切り出すことができる。
関数形式
substring(カラムまたは文字列, 開始位置, 長さ);
使用例
SELECT substring("abcdef", 3, 2)
上記の例を実行すると、次のように表示される。
cd